Transaction 26e2842138973a6166b922a7751273cf291243dfb5feb5d362ca498a67a017a7
1 Input
1 Output
-
26e2842138973a6166b922a7751273cf291243dfb5feb5d362ca498a67a017a7:0
- value
- 160000
- script pubkey
- OP_0 OP_PUSHBYTES_20 5fe180a6fdb592e69d12ad58476ea69ca4b9a17f
- address
- bc1qtlscpfhakkfwd8gj44vywm4xnjjtngtladr9rg